ADC

Liaison globale des stratégies de transformation d’URL

Après avoir configuré vos stratégies de transformation d’URL, vous les liez à Global ou à un point de liaison pour les mettre en œuvre. Après la liaison, toute requête ou réponse qui correspond à une stratégie de transformation d’URL est transformée par le profil associé à cette stratégie.

Lorsque vous liez une stratégie, vous lui attribuez une priorité. La priorité détermine l’ordre dans lequel les stratégies que vous définissez sont évaluées. Vous pouvez définir la priorité sur n’importe quel nombre entier positif. Dans le système d’exploitation NetScaler, les priorités stratégies fonctionnent dans l’ordre inverse : plus le chiffre est élevé, plus la priorité est faible.

Étant donné que la fonction de transformation d’URL implémente uniquement la première stratégie correspondant à une demande, et non les stratégies supplémentaires qu’elle pourrait également correspondre, la priorité de stratégie est importante pour obtenir les résultats que vous souhaitez obtenir. Si vous attribuez à votre première stratégie une faible priorité (par exemple, 1000), vous demandez au NetScaler de ne l’exécuter que si les autres stratégies ayant une priorité plus élevée ne correspondent pas à une demande. Si vous attribuez à votre première stratégie une priorité élevée (par exemple, 1), vous demandez au NetScaler de l’exécuter en premier et d’ignorer toute autre stratégie susceptible de correspondre. Vous pouvez vous laisser beaucoup de place pour ajouter d’autres stratégies dans n’importe quel ordre, sans avoir à réaffecter des priorités, en définissant des priorités avec des intervalles de 50 ou 100 entre chaque stratégie lorsque vous liez globalement vos stratégies.

Remarque : Les stratégies de transformation d’URL ne peuvent pas être liées à des serveurs virtuels basés sur TCP.

Pour lier une stratégie de transformation d’URL à l’aide de la ligne de commande NetScaler

À l’invite de commande NetScaler, tapez les commandes suivantes pour lier globalement une stratégie de transformation d’URL et vérifier la configuration :

  • bind transform global <policyName> <priority>
  • show transform global

Exemple :


> bind transform global polisearching 100
 Done
> show transform global
1)      Policy Name: polisearching
        Priority: 100

 Done
<!--NeedCopy-->

Pour lier une stratégie de transformation d’URL à l’aide de l’utilitaire de configuration

  1. Dans le volet de navigation, développez Réécrire, puis Transformation d’URL, puis cliquez sur **Stratégies.
  2. Dans le volet d’informations, cliquez sur Gestionnaire de stratégies.
  3. Dans la boîte de dialogue Transformer le Gestionnaire de stratégies, choisissez le point de liaison auquel vous souhaitez lier la stratégie**. Les choix sont les suivants :
    • Remplacer Global. Les stratégies liées à ce point de liaison traitent tout le trafic provenant de toutes les interfaces de l’appliance NetScaler et sont appliquées avant toute autre stratégie.
    • Serveur virtuel LB. Les stratégies liées à un serveur virtuel d’équilibrage de charge sont appliquées uniquement au trafic traité par ce serveur virtuel d’équilibrage de charge et sont appliquées avant toute stratégie globale par défaut. Après avoir sélectionné Serveur virtuel LB, vous devez également sélectionner le serveur virtuel d’équilibrage de charge spécifique auquel vous souhaitez lier cette stratégie.
    • Serveur virtuel CS. Les stratégies liées à un serveur virtuel de commutation de contenu sont appliquées uniquement au trafic traité par ce serveur virtuel de commutation de contenu et sont appliquées avant toute stratégie globale par défaut. Après avoir sélectionné CS Virtual Server, vous devez également sélectionner le serveur virtuel de commutation de contenu spécifique auquel vous souhaitez lier cette stratégie.
    • Global par défaut. Les stratégies liées à ce point de liaison traitent l’ensemble du trafic provenant de toutes les interfaces de l’appliance NetScaler.
    • Étiquette de stratégie. Les stratégies liées à un trafic de traitement d’étiquette de stratégie que l’étiquette de stratégie leur achemine. L’étiquette de stratégie contrôle l’ordre dans lequel les stratégies sont appliquées à ce trafic.
  4. Sélectionnez Insérer une stratégie pour insérer une nouvelle ligne et afficher une liste déroulante contenant toutes les stratégies de transformation d’URL non liées disponibles.
  5. Sélectionnez la stratégie que vous souhaitez lier ou sélectionnez Nouvelle stratégie pour créer une nouvelle stratégie. La stratégie que vous avez sélectionnée ou créée est insérée dans la liste des stratégies de transformation d’URL liées globalement.
  6. Apportez tous les ajustements supplémentaires à la reliure.
    • Pour modifier la priorité de la stratégie, cliquez sur le champ pour l’activer, puis tapez une nouvelle priorité. Vous pouvez également sélectionner Régénérer les priorités pour renuméroter les priorités de manière uniforme.
    • Pour modifier l’expression de stratégie, double-cliquez sur ce champ pour ouvrir la boîte de dialogue Configurer la stratégie de transformation, dans laquelle vous pouvez modifier l’expression de stratégie.
    • Pour définir l’expression Goto, double-cliquez sur le champ dans l’en-tête de la colonne Goto Expression pour afficher la liste déroulante dans laquelle vous pouvez choisir une expression.
    • Pour définir l’option Invoquer, double-cliquez sur le champ dans l’en-tête de la colonne Invoquer pour afficher la liste déroulante dans laquelle vous pouvez choisir une expression.
  7. Répétez les étapes 3 à 6 pour ajouter les stratégies de transformation d’URL supplémentaires que vous souhaitez lier globalement.
  8. Cliquez sur OK pour enregistrer vos modifications. Un message apparaît dans la barre d’état indiquant que la stratégie a été configurée avec succès.
Liaison globale des stratégies de transformation d’URL